آموزش کوبرنتیز | Kubernetes Add-Ons – بخش ۴ (Velero, MinIO, ArgoCD و GitOps)

مدیریت بکاپ و خودکارسازی استقرارها در Kubernetes بسیار مهم است. در این ویدئو یاد می‌گیرید چطور با ابزارهایی مثل Kubernetes Velero Backup ، MinIO و ArgoCD کلاستر خود را امن‌تر و فرایندهای CI/CD را پیشرفته‌تر کنید.

یکی از چالش‌های اصلی در مدیریت Kubernetes، بکاپ‌گیری از منابع و خودکارسازی استقرارها است. برای حل این مسائل، ابزارهای قدرتمندی مثل Velero، MinIO و ArgoCD وجود دارند. در این قسمت چهارم از سری Add-ons به بررسی این ابزارها می‌پردازیم:Kubernetes Velero Backup

🔹 Velero + MinIO

  • Velero ابزاری برای بکاپ و بازیابی منابع Kubernetes و Persistent Volumeها است.

  • MinIO یک Object Storage سازگار با S3 است که به‌عنوان مقصد ذخیره‌سازی Velero استفاده می‌شود.

  • ترکیب Velero و MinIO یک راهکار ساده و مؤثر برای مدیریت بکاپ‌هاست.

🔹 ArgoCD

  • ابزاری قدرتمند برای پیاده‌سازی GitOps در Kubernetes.

  • امکان همگام‌سازی وضعیت کلاستر با Git Repository.

  • ساده‌سازی فرآیند استقرار و بروزرسانی اپلیکیشن‌ها.

 GitOps + CI/CD

  • با ترکیب ArgoCD و CI/CD می‌توانید فرآیند خودکارسازی استقرار را کامل کنید.

  • هر تغییری در Git به‌طور خودکار به کلاستر منتقل می‌شود.

  • این روش شفافیت، قابلیت ردیابی و سرعت در DevOps را افزایش می‌دهد.

🎯 در این ویدئو یاد می‌گیرید چگونه با استفاده از Velero، MinIO و ArgoCD، بکاپ‌گیری ایمن داشته باشید و فرآیند استقرار اپلیکیشن‌ها را با GitOps خودکار کنید.

کانال یوتوب

پیمایش به بالا